Sen. Elizabeth Warren and John Deaton debate in Springfield
Oct 15, 2024
SPRINGFIELD, Mass. (WWLP) - Incumbent Senator Elizabeth Warren will face off this week against her Republican challenger for a debate in Springfield.

Challenger John Deaton and Senator Warren will take the stage at New England Public Media's studios on Thursday at 7 p.m. The debate will be moderated by reporters from NEPM and WGBH news.
“This is the only US Senate debate to be held here in western Massachusetts, and we’re honored to be hosting Senator Warren and Mr. Deaton at our studios in downtown Springfield,” said John Sutton, Vice President of Content and Audience Strategy for NEPM. "Public media plays an essential role in keeping voters informed, and providing clear, unbiased information that helps people make the choices that affect their lives and communities.”
Where to watch
The live stream will be available online at gbhnews.org and the GBH News and NEPM YouTube channels. The debate will be rebroadcast on Saturday at 4 p.m. ET on 88.5 NEPM and Sunday on NEPM TV at 7 p.m., GBH 2 at 6 p.m., and GBH 89.7 at 7 p.m.
Warren is running for a third term in the U.S. Senate. Deaton is an attorney and a U.S. Marine veteran who has never held public office. Recent polling shows Warren has a commanding lead.
Deaton is also running against history, the last time a Republican defeated an incumbent U.S. senator in Massachusetts was in 1924, exactly 100 years ago.
